EDITORS COMMENTS
This diagram, titled "Mvem. Showing the Planets Mercury, Venus, Earth, and Mars, in their Orbs," was created in 1849 and is an intriguing glimpse into the historical understanding of our solar system. The diagram, from the Mary Evans Picture Library, depicts the first four planets from the Sun in their relative positions, with Mercury, the smallest and closest planet, shown at the left, followed by Venus, Earth, and Mars. Mary Evans Picture Library, a renowned archive of historical images, has made this rare and fascinating diagram available to us today. At the time this diagram was created, our knowledge of the solar system was still evolving. The planets were known to ancient civilizations, but it wasn't until the telescopic discoveries of Galileo Galilei in the late 16th and early 17th centuries that their true nature was revealed. This diagram, therefore, represents an important historical milestone in the study of astronomy.
